The invention provides a kind of flood control rainwater feelings automatic monitoring system, including control centre, dispatch branch center, communication network
Network, cloud computing end, mobile terminal and rainwater feelings automatic monitor station;Wherein control centre is by communication network and one or more tune
Degree branch center communication connects, and one or more scheduling branch centers are supervised with mobile terminal and rainwater feelings respectively automatically by communication network
Survey station communication connects, and connects also by communication network communication each other;Cloud computing end by communication network respectively with scheduling in
The heart, scheduling branch center, mobile terminal and rainwater feelings automatic monitor station communication connect;
Wherein cloud computing end receive and store, analytical calculation from control centre, dispatch branch center, mobile terminal and/or
The data of rainwater feelings automatic monitor station, and also the various data of local server can be shared, mode actively or passively is sent out
Give control centre, dispatch branch center, mobile terminal and/or the data of rainwater feelings automatic monitor station.
The whole river water level of control centre's centralized displaying, rainfall, video image and/or scene photograph, and generate form
With curve.
Scheduling branch center shows in real time and stores the waterlevel data in each river course, the rainfall product data administered, video image
And/or scene photograph, when water level rainfall occurring beyond warning, it is possible to and alarm, and be sent to warning message move
Dynamic terminal.
Rainwater feelings automatic monitor station includes rain hydrology monitor terminal, and rainwater feelings measure sensor, video equipment, switch,
Optical transmitter and receiver;Wherein rainwater feelings measure sensor and video equipment passes through communication network and is connected with rain hydrology monitor terminal respectively, and/
Or rainwater feelings measurement sensor is connected with rain hydrology monitor terminal by communication network, video equipment and rain hydrology monitor terminal lead to
Crossing communication network and connect switch respectively, switch is connected with optical transmitter and receiver by communication network.
Communication network is wireless communication networks and/or wire communication network.
Wire communication network is optical fiber communication network.
Rainwater feelings measure sensor be water-level gauge, rain gage bucket, current meter, thermometer, hygroscopic one or more.

Data are transmitted
Wireless transmission terminal and wire transmission terminal can be made according to field condition:
1) wire transmission terminal: support RJ45 interface or 485 interfaces;
2) wireless transmission terminal: by wireless network transmissions data, terminal has long-term online, instant messaging feature, eventually
End can simultaneously with at least 1~4 center to center communications.
Water level, rainfall information gathering:
1) information such as Real-time Collection water level value, water-level gauge fault (switching) state, and water-level gauge range setting can be carried out;
2) Real-time Collection rainfall intensity, hour rainfall, daily rainfall, field rainfall information, and pluviometer resolution can be set
The relevant informations such as rate.
Water level alarm is reported to the police
Support arranges multistage water level threshold, supports water position status change active reporting warning information, ensures information
Instantaneity, high efficiency.
Rain condition early warning
Support arranges multistage raininess grade threshold, status of support change active reporting warning information, ensures information
Instantaneity, high efficiency.
Camera function
1) timing is taken pictures and is added warning and take pictures and deposit;
2) when water level alarm is reported to the police, taken pictures in scene by terminal automatically, and transmits photo to centring system;
3) timing photo opporunity interval, terminal automatic camera can be set, and photo is transmitted to centring system.
Transmission of video images function
Installing web camera can be by continuous print transmission of video images to center by fiber optic network.
Support active reporting (timing reports, reporting to the police reports)+systems soft ware inquiry:
1) active reporting: active reporting includes that timing reports, alerts active reporting, refer to monitoring point detection and control terminal actively to
Center sends measuring point data or photo;
2) systems soft ware is inquired: remote measurement includes that timing is called survey together, immediately called survey together, refers to that monitoring system transmitting order to lower levels calls survey together
Monitoring point waterlevel data or take pictures.
Historical record storage, data power down are not lost, clock keeps function
Remotely operation and maintenance: parameter is set, calls survey data together, take pictures:
1) ginseng is remotely set: detection and control terminal supports remotely located detection and control terminal parameter.Support remotely located water level parameters (bag
Include: water-level gauge range, water level alarm line value etc.);
2) remote measurement, remote photographic: detection and control terminal is supported remote measurement current level monitoring information or takes pictures.
Lightning protection function
Detection and control terminal all input and output are gone between (such as power line, sensor lead, order wire etc.) all take multistage every
From, absorb measure, avoid the overvoltage overcurrent such as the thunderbolt destruction to controller to greatest extent.

Water-level gauge:
Measure reservoir level and typically use ultrasonic level gage, non-cpntact measurement, not by water pollution, do not destroy water knot
Structure;
Directly hang and be arranged on the water surface, not by Lidar Equation;
It is not required to build well logging, saves construction investment;
Flange or threaded, easy for installation;
Liquid crystal display, convenient debugging and maintenance.
(2) important technological parameters
Power supply: 24VDC signal exports: 4~20mA
Range: 1,3,5,7,10,12,15,17,20m
Transmitting full-shape: 6 °~9 °
Precision: 0.25~0.5%FS
Display: 6 LCD liquid crystal displays, uses the waterproof upper cover of visual type
Mode of operation: measure distance and measurement liquid level pattern is convertible
Liquid level pattern: point ' setting height(from bottom) ' pattern or ' current level ' pattern, optional
Current tracking: ' abnormal the most i.e. with ' pattern or ' abnormal wait ' pattern, menu is optional
Blind area: 0.25~0.90m (size and the range capability of blind area are directly proportional)
Resolving power: during measurement distance < 10m → 1mm;During measurement distance >=10m → 10mm
Degree of protection: Ip66.
Ambient temperature :-25~+65 DEG C
Overall dimensions: 255 (high) × 145 (wide) do not contain waterproof inlet wire head × 138 (deeply)
Installation form: perforate nut is installed or installs flange (non-standard configuration) additional
Rib-loop specification: thread size G2 perforate G2+3mm
Sheathing material: high intensity engineering nylon, (specialty anti-corrosion type is polytetrafluoroethylene)

Information Security
Owing to water level, rainfall product data are basis and the keys of flood control, system is run by its real time data and management comes
Saying it is the most valuable, therefore this system guarantees that the integrity of data is extremely important after setting up.
(1) data send affirmation mechanism
System allows to be set as significant data or important website from reporting confirmation mode of operation, when water level, rainfall monitoring
Data of standing can wait after offering center that center receives the confirmation of data, otherwise back into repeating transmission or the replacing communication media of row data,
To ensure that center receives Monitoring Data.
(2) operation identification
System centre workstation software has operator's identification, to prevent maloperation and malice from invading.
(3) log recording
System provides telemetry system initial data log recording and operation note, follows the trail of and fault recovery for accident.
System reliability
Owing to all monitoring stations of this system are completely in wild environment, requiring the highest to system reliable, native system is main
Take the measure of following several respects:
(1) low-power consumption: owing to water level, rainfall monitoring station do not have reliable AC power to ensure, therefore selects equipment all to adopt
Use low power consuming devices.
(2) moistureproof: system equipment is installed and protected mode to consider that local air humidity is big, and survey station equipment requirements is at high humidity
Ensure under environment that system is properly functioning.
